If WebView2 is absent on the system when Prism is installed, the Prism installer will seamlessly install this component for you. On older systems, WebView2 is installed as part of Microsoft Office updates. In fact, this is a standard part of Windows 11. Usually, you do not need to do anything special in order to install Microsoft Edge WebView2. In particular, the Learn section of Prism's Welcome Dialog relies heavily on this component. The Microsoft Edge WebView2 rendering component is required by Prism in order to display various high-quality, dynamic content in the user interface. WebView2 relies on Microsoft Edge as the rendering engine used to display web (HTML) content within the application. This component allows for the integration of modern web technologies within desktop applications. Since the release of Prism 9.3.0, Prism on Windows has required the installation of the Microsoft Edge WebView2 rendering component. ![]()
